Peckham Industries Inc. (PII) has been a family-run business since
1924 and we believe our “family by choice” philosophy delivers
value as the trusted supplier of construction materials, products,
and services in the communities we serve. Through our extensive
network of hot mix asphalt and ready-mix concrete plants, quarries,
and liquid asphalt terminals, PII delivers the highest quality
materials and custom solutions to thousands of road construction
and road maintenance customers. In addition, the company’s
construction operations include paving and road reclamation
services, as well as precast/pre-stressed concrete production and
erection of multi-level parking structures, specialty buildings,
and bridge components. Become part of our mission by realizing your
purpose, serving our community interests, and delivering growth for
our customers. Peckham Industries educates, innovates, and applies
technology in a way that is safe, sustainable, inclusive, and
profitable. Position Description Job Summary: The Plant Manager
will oversee the day-to-day operations of our quarry and hot mix
plant. prioritizing efficient production, safety protocols, and
environmental responsibility. This role entails supervising staff,
organizing equipment upkeep, and collaborating with different
departments to achieve production goals while upholding stringent
quality and safety standards. Moreover, the Plant Manager will
handle budgetary matters, control expenses, and strive to meet key
performance indicators (KPIs) pertaining to production output,
safety measures, and financial objectives. Essential Functions: 1.
Protect family and friends. Uphold a strong safety culture by
engaging employees, prioritizing zero incidents, and adhering to
company and federal safety policies and procedures. Take proactive
measures and implement necessary corrective actions to maintain a
safe workplace. 2. Dedication. Demonstrate leadership by fostering
team mastery and humility. Provide leadership, resources, and
processes to ensure reliable, quality-driven plant operations.
Coordinate production scheduling, raw material procurement, and
maintenance efforts with a focus on preventive maintenance and
continuous improvement. 3. Ownership and caring. Take ownership of
the safe operation of plant equipment to deliver quality products
meeting customer specifications and expectations. 4. Communicate
effectively with customers to enhance value through quality,
service, production, and scheduling. 5. Results matter. Plan and
establish work schedules, assignments, and production sequences to
achieve production and performance objectives. Understand and work
towards financial goals by developing annual budgets, winter
maintenance plans, and capital expenditure plans. 6. Obligated.
Identify and resolve regulatory, safety, personnel, and production
issues promptly, either directly or by collaborating with
cross-functional teams. 7. Focused. Implement preventative
maintenance schedules to minimize downtime. 8. Respect and engage.
Collaborate with the Technical Services department to ensure
compliance with operating permit conditions and environmental
regulations while aligning with the operating plan for mine site
development. 9. Our word is our bond. Serve as the primary advocate
for operations within the community, fostering respectful
engagement with neighbors, local agencies, governmental bodies, and
the broader community. Position Requirements Requirements,
